-
Type: Task
-
Resolution: Fixed
-
Priority: Major - P3
-
Affects Version/s: None
-
Component/s: Sharding
-
Fully Compatible
-
Sharding 2018-07-02, Sharding 2018-07-16, Sharding 2018-07-30
Once the state transition table has been fleshed out in the design, this ticket is to implement the participant and coordinator transition tables and unit test them.
- is depended on by
-
SERVER-35358 Implement the Transaction coordinator beginTransaction/waitForAllParticipantsPrepared state machine
- Closed
-
SERVER-35362 Make `Session` decorable and add Transaction Coordinator and Participant as decorations
- Closed
-
SERVER-36122 Implement the router side of the distributed commit protocol
- Closed
- is duplicated by
-
SERVER-35358 Implement the Transaction coordinator beginTransaction/waitForAllParticipantsPrepared state machine
- Closed
-
SERVER-35360 Transaction participant internal state machine
- Closed